. Barracuda Networks is proud to be an Equal Opportunity Employer, committed to equal employment opportunity and equitable...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business deserves access...
as an organization. Barracuda Networks is proud to be an Equal Opportunity Employer, committed to equal employment opportunity...Job ID 25-337 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business...
customer service a passion of yours? Barracuda Networks is looking for experienced Contact Center Representatives...Job ID 25-474 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business...
service a passion of yours? Barracuda Networks is looking for experienced Contact Center Representatives to join our team...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business deserves access...
. Barracuda Networks is proud to be an employer that complies with all applicable national, state and local laws pertaining...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business deserves access...
and strength as an organization. Barracuda Networks is proud to be an employer that complies with all applicable national, state...Job ID: 25-348 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every...
. Barracuda Networks is proud to be an employer that complies with all applicable national, state and local laws pertaining...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business deserves access...
and strength as an organization. Barracuda Networks is proud to be an employer that complies with all applicable national, state...Job ID: 25-406 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every...
. Barracuda Networks is proud to be an employer that complies with all applicable national, state and local laws pertaining...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business deserves access...
and strength as an organization. Barracuda Networks is proud to be an employer that complies with all applicable national, state...Req ID: 25-405 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every...
. Barracuda Networks is proud to be an employer that complies with all applicable national, state and local laws pertaining...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business deserves access...
. Barracuda Networks is proud to be an employer that complies with all applicable national, state and local laws pertaining to non...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business deserves access...
as an organization. Barracuda Networks is proud to be an employer that complies with all applicable national, state and local laws...Job ID 25-300 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business...
and strength as an organization. Barracuda Networks is proud to be an employer that complies with all applicable national, state...Job ID: 25-265 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every...
and strength as an organization. Barracuda Networks is proud to be an employer that complies with all applicable national, state...Job ID: 25-291 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every...
. Barracuda Networks is proud to be an employer that complies with all applicable national, state and local laws pertaining...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business deserves access...
and strength as an organization. Barracuda Networks is proud to be an employer that complies with all applicable national, state...Job ID: 25-396 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every...
. Barracuda Networks is proud to be an employer that complies with all applicable national, state and local laws pertaining...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business deserves access...
and strength as an organization. Barracuda Networks is proud to be an employer that complies with all applicable national, state...Req ID: 25-391 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every...
. Barracuda Networks is proud to be an employer that complies with all applicable national, state, and local laws pertaining...Come Join Our Passionate Team! At Barracuda, we make the world a safer place. We believe every business deserves access...